Claims of PALM Scheme suspension are false

The Ministry of Foreign Affairs and External Trade has dismissed recent social media reports alleging the suspension of the Pacific Australia Labour Mobility Scheme, calling them false and misleading.

According to the Ministry, a post circulating online claiming that Australian Prime Minister Anthony Albanese has threatened to suspend the PALM Scheme due to crimes committed by Fijians is entirely fabricated.

The Ministry says it has confirmed with Australian authorities that no such statement has been issued by the Australian Government.

It reassures all PALM workers and stakeholders that the partnership with Australia remains strong and the scheme continues to operate as normal.

The Ministry is urging members of the public to avoid spreading or engaging with such false information, and to refer directly to official sources for verified updates.
